The interactive mirror

For the open-air museum Skansen in Stockholm Cordura has developed "The interactive mirror".

The interactive mirror is an unique opportunity for the museum visitors to interact with the museum objects without physically touching them.

At Skansen the visitors can try on clothes from the old days on their own body.
By stepping in front of the interactive screen (mirror) the guest will be digitally dressed in the clothing.

The visitors can change clothes using a simple 'swipe' gesture with either right or left hand, and a new suit appears and covers the body - just like a cut-out doll.

The solution has spread joy to both adults and the younger visitors at the museum.

The solution for Skansen is Corduras first international interactive installation.
